just buying a 2002 princess with TAMD 74P EDC. Was surpised to discover that Volvo are still carrying out retrofits to the EDC system. I know they were very unreliable in the mid 90's but assumed they were fixed by 2002?
The latest mod seems to be replacing some of the connections in the main connector block as they had a problem of going intermittent.

Anyone got any info or experiences on this model I might need to be aware of?
 
Have 74p EDC's on F43, have had the recall letter to get "connections" replaced, will get done in 2006. Only problem we have had was with the multi station selection unit. It failed the day before our annual vacation big trip. Thick end of £1k later fixed it!! Not covered on Warranty as 2 months over 24 months old.

I suspect the "connection" recall is also to gain access to upgrade software that has caused sporadic revving on some boats, more with 75's than 74's though. Big case in Southern France apparently was mentioned by Insurance Company during a claim by a friend who "thought" he had perhaps caught throttle with knee. Now not sure but he covered 3rd party costs, so as to skirt delay due to other case and get boat back in water.

Big problems on all small engine EDC's from volvo I have 72p's both have gone, the boast sensor which is embedded fails its a £20 bit but will cost 1400 to replace each as MK1 no longer available. Its a known problem worldwide with volvos but they refuse to acknowledge problem, I think in USA there was a court case in progress at some time.
If you search the mails for volvo EDC of Doffy then you will see the inputs from others.
I had a cracked sump again no interest from volvo the engine was repaired by Volvo agaent it now vibrates like mad and Volvo man can't find problem it also cannot reach 2500 rpm, I found a few problems but this has been going on since the summer.
My advise unless you can afford to buy new volvos 72-75 series at end of warranty then look elsewhere.

Volvo will charge for software upgrade.

Get a volvo man in with PC to check the EDC it will also tell you a lot about the engine hours max revs etc and lots more. it will take no more than 30 mins to check two engines.

Check condition of fly throttles if open to elements the pots can be a problem.

I've got a 2001 Princess with EDC's on 74P's and have had the mod done. I really wouldn't worry about it; the mod, apparently cures a problem (though I've not experienced it)whereby the engines can engage when the throttle position is in neutral; another part of the mod is to put a piece of foam inside the relay box, which stops the engine from stalling as a result of the stop relay vibrating too much.

My engines have been Ok (seriously touching wood here), though I look after them with tender loving care.......
 
Kindly confirm do I need to replace boost sensors coz have an opinion of replacing air pressure sensor.
To test for incorrect signals in relation to actual temp or pressure you need to plug in diagnostics key , for example if the boost temp is reading 99deh c when it’s actually 18 deg it will back off the fuel , that’s an example .
you can get the resistance info and test each sensor with a multi meter , but that’s hard work .
